About Lawrence M. Carey

Lawrence M. Carey is a scholar working on Toxicology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Pharmacology, having authored 17 papers that have together received 347 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cannabis and Cannabinoid Research (8 papers), Pain Mechanisms and Treatments (7 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(5 papers),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(3 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(3 papers),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(3 papers), Forensic Toxicology and Drug Analysis (3 papers) and Ion channel regulation and function (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pharmacology (157 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(164 citations) and Toxicology (29 citations). Lawrence M. Carey has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Spain and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Andrea G. Hohmann, Ken Mackie, Ailing Li, Wan-Hung Lee, Tannia Gutierrez, Alexandros Makriyannis, Richard A. Slivicki, Heather B. Bradshaw, Emma Leishman and Xiaoyan Lin. Their work appears in journals such as Current Biology, Scientific Reports and Pain.
